Tenant Improvement Program

Description

SmartRiverside, in keeping with its goal of attracting and fostering both new and existing technology companies in the City of Riverside, has developed the High Technology Tenant Improvement Program. Under the High Technology Tenant Improvement Program grants may be awarded to small technology companies with sales of less than $20 Million per year.  The program is designed to help offset tenant improvement costs for small technology companies, allowing them to redirect capital. 

 

Eligibility

To be eligible for the SmartRiverside Tenant Improvement grant, companies must meet all of the following eligibility requirements

  1. Companies must report less than $20 million in annual sales. 
  2. Companies must fall within the following North American Industry Classification System (NAICS):
    3341 - Computer and peripheral equipment manufacturing
    3342 - Communications equipment manufacturing
    3343 - Audio and video equipment manufacturing
    3344 - Semiconductor and other electronic component manufacturing
    3345 - Navigational, measuring, electromedical and control instruments              
                manufacturing
    3346 - Manufacturing and reproducing magnetic and optical media
    3353 - Electrical equipment manufacturing
    33599 - All other electrical and component manufacturing
    3391 - Medical equipment and supplies manufacturing
    5112 - Software publishers
    514191 - On-line information services
    5142 - Data processing services
    5415 - Computer systems design and related services
    5416 - Management, scientific, and technical consulting services
    5417 - Scientific research and development services

Note: If a company does not fall into any of the above categories but has any intellectual properties, then they will also be eligible for consideration.

  1. The space must be within the City of Riverside city limits.
SmartRiverside reserves the right to reject grants to companies that do not fall within the eligibility requirements or those companies that do not represent a technology use.

Uses

Grants can only be used for technology-related tenant improvements and could include, but not limited to, the following uses: wet laboratory space, fiber optic connections, special lighting requirements, specialized equipment, and other similar uses.

Grant Amount

Grants will be limited to a maximum of $20,000 per company. Grants will be awarded on a first come, first serve basis contingent upon availability of funds. Grants will be made as reimbursements only.  Companies must show receipts and document work performed. Grants will also be subject to availability of funds through SmartRiverside.

Procedures

To receive funds from the SmartRiverside Tenant Improvement Program, a potential company must meet the above eligibility criteria and do the following:

  1. Complete and submit the Tenant Improvement Application.

The form can be downloaded from link above.  Along with the application, include three (3) letters of support.  Mail or submit the application and letters of support to:

SmartRiverside
Tenant Improvement Program
3900 Main Street,
5th Floor
Riverside, CA 92522

  1. Once the application has been submitted, the SmartRiverside 

      Tenant Improvement Advisory Board will review the request for           
      approval. The Advisory Board will have up to sixty (60) days from the time of  
      submittal to review the application. 

2a. If approved, the Advisory Board will make a formal recommendation   
      for funding at the next scheduled SmartRiverside Board meeting
     
2b. If denied, a denial letter will be sent to the applicant within thirty 
      (30) days of denial. A decision for denial will be final unless changed
      circumstances can be shown.

  1. After the SmartRiverside Board has approved the application, the applicant will be notified within one (1) week of the approval.
  1. Once notified, the applicant will have one (1) calendar year to submit a copy of the SmartRiverside Tenant Improvement Reimbursement Form with receipts of all approved tenant improvements. 
  1. An applicant may only be eligible to apply for funds once, unless the applicant moves into a larger facility or increases the size of its current facility.             

6.   An applicant must continue to operate their business within the City of Riverside
     for at least five years, or be required to reimburse SmartRiverside an amount equal
     to 20% of the initial grant award for each year remaining in the five-year
     commitment period.

Note: Company may be asked to present project before the SmartRiverside Tenant Improvement Program Advisory Board or SmartRiverside Board.
